Output 3a6abc70d75d18297eb35e59cea14b30c20f6039c5d82db464e568b92cc9e4ca:42

value
41429658
script pubkey
OP_0 OP_PUSHBYTES_20 e995b284e0ed650d596fb318897e06209d72e058
address
bc1qax2m9p8qa4js6kt0kvvgjlsxyzwh9czch9h2mn
transaction
3a6abc70d75d18297eb35e59cea14b30c20f6039c5d82db464e568b92cc9e4ca
spent
true